Can someone explain me where did I go wrong?
Ways in which 7 people can be arranged: 7!.... (a)
Ways in which all girls are arranged together: 7P5...... (b)
(as all girls are treated as 1)
So a-b: 7!- 7P5
You have negated only the cases where all 3 girls are seated together.
There are still other scenarios where two girls can be seated together. For example BGGBBBG, GBGGBBB, GGBBGBB, etc. These are also not allowed as per our question. No two girls can be seated together.
